Smart Weather Sensors



Smart weather sensors have actually revolutionized the efficiency of modern irrigation systems by changing sprinkling routines based on real-time environmental information. These sensing units monitor variables such as temperature level, humidity, wind rate, and solar radiation, permitting systems to react dynamically to changing climate condition. By integrating this data, smart sensing units can enhance water usage, decreasing waste and making sure that landscapes obtain the ideal quantity of moisture. This technology not only saves water however likewise promotes much healthier plant development by preventing overwatering or underwatering. Furthermore, the automation offered by wise weather condition sensing units enhances user ease, as house owners and landscapers can rely upon accurate watering routines without hands-on treatment. On the whole, these innovations stand for a significant advancement in sustainable irrigation techniques.

Soil Wetness Sensors



Soil dampness sensors play a vital function in modern-day irrigation systems, offering real-time information that boosts water efficiency. These tools determine the volumetric water content in the soil, enabling precise evaluations of moisture levels. By incorporating dirt dampness sensing units into watering systems, users can prevent overwatering or underwatering, ultimately advertising healthier plant growth and conserving water resources.The sensing units send data to controllers, which can adjust sprinkling schedules based on existing soil conditions. This data-driven technique minimizes water waste and assurances that plants receive the most effective quantity of moisture. In addition, soil moisture sensors can be beneficial in numerous agricultural setups, from home yards to large ranches. The implementation of these sensing units adds to lasting techniques by sustaining responsible water usage and decreasing environmental influence. Overall, the unification of soil wetness sensing units notes a significant innovation in attaining efficient watering systems.
